How do You Protect Your Rights After a Collision?
You can take a few steps to protect your right to compensation after a crash. You should document the crash, collect proof to support your case, seek medical care for your injuries, and call a legal professional.
Document the Crash
If you are physically able, you should:
- Call 911 to report the collision to the local police department or sheriff’s office.
- Photograph your injuries, the accident scene, and the vehicle damage.
- Don’t take responsibility for what happened or apologize to anyone.
- Gather contact information for witnesses willing to testify.
Follow these steps to document the crash site while the evidence is fresh and accurate. The data you gather at this stage will strengthen your insurance claim.
Seek Medical Treatment
You should seek medical attention after a motor vehicle accident, even if you do not see any visible wounds. Certain injuries may not become obvious immediately; however, a doctor can accurately diagnose your accident-related conditions.
Document all doctor appointments, take notes and provide any other information about the injuries you suffered to your lawyer.
Take Notes About Everything
Write down what occurred during the crash and describe the immediate aftermath. Note your emotions after the collision and how your injuries have impacted you. Additionally, keep track of the contact details of witnesses and those involved in the crash.
Get Estimates for Car Repairs
Research how much it would cost to repair your car (or replace it if it’s totaled). Get a few estimates from different services before the insurance company gets involved.
Document Your Damages
Organize all relevant information regarding your accident and hand these over to your lawyer. This should include the following:
- Your personal injury claim
- The insurance agent’s name
- All medical records and bills
- Vehicle damage repair bills

How Can You Protect Your Interests from Insurance Companies?
After being involved in a collision, the other driver’s insurance company may call you to discuss the incident. The insurance agent will sound friendly and sympathetic, luring you into a false sense of security.
Nothing could be further from the truth. Insurance companies profit by paying minimum amounts on a claim. Therefore, the money the insurance company offers may not cover your initial medical care, let alone the cost of long-term medical treatment.
Common insurance company tactics include:
- Offering you a quick settlement: They will close the case quickly before you learn more about your future expenses. By accepting their offer, you’ll sign away your right to future compensation.
- Delaying the processing of your claim: They may wait long before doing anything, hoping you’ll get desperate and take whatever they eventually offer.
- Blaming you for the crash or claiming your injuries aren’t serious: They may claim the crash was your fault or try to devalue your claim by saying that your injuries are unrelated to the incident.
Without a lawyer, it’s hard to recognize these tricks and fight against them. Working with a skilled Macon car accident attorney helps level the playing field. In addition, insurance companies try to avoid confrontation with legal professionals and may even offer more money when they learn you have legal counsel.
What Kinds of Compensation Are Available in a Macon Car Crash Case?
In Macon-Bibb County, you can recover multiple types of damages, depending on your circumstances. We commonly recover the following for our clients:
- Medical costs
- Property damage
- Lost wages and future income
- Loss of consortium
- Pain and suffering
- Emotional distress
- Loss of enjoyment of life
When a collision is especially severe, you may recover additional damages. For example, this may happen if you face a permanent physical disability, chronic pain, or the loss of a family member. Punitive damages may also be awarded in rare situations.
Although we understand that no sum of money can replace what you have lost, we also acknowledge that receiving a just settlement can facilitate the process of reconstructing your life. Do You Have to Go to Court for a Car Accident Claim?
Car accident cases are typically settled out of court, with approximately 95% resolved through negotiation. We can negotiate with the insurance company and settle your claim without a court trial.
We will take your case to court if an insurance company refuses to negotiate. If you pursue legal action, our litigation team will stand by your side.

Car Accident Statistics for Georgia
Georgia has seen its fair share of car accidents over the years, with statistics indicating that the number of collisions in the state has remained relatively consistent.
According to the Georgia Governor’s Office of Highway Safety, there were 1,797 fatal car accidents in Georgia in 2021. This is a slight increase from the 1,658 fatal accidents in 2020.
Most Dangerous Intersections in Macon, GA
Intersections are one of the most dangerous areas for drivers on the road. This is because intersections are where different traffic streams converge, often at high speeds.
Also, multiple vehicles may turn, change lanes, or exit the roadway. As a result, drivers may be distracted, confused, or not pay close attention to their surroundings, which can lead to collisions.
According to the local news station WGXA, the following are among the most dangerous intersections in Macon:
- Gray Highway and Shurling Drive
- Riverside Drive and Northside Drive
- Mercer University and Log Cabin Drive
- Gray Highway and Clinton Road
- Eisenhower Parkway and Log Cabin Drive
